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Southwest High School is located on the far southwest side of San Antonio, situated within a developing suburban area. The campus is accessible via Highway 90 and Interstate 35, with Dragon Lane serving as the primary entrance for many athletic events. For those flying in, San Antonio International Airport (SAT) is the closest major airport, typically a 30-45 minute drive depending on traffic. Public transportation options are limited in this part of the city, making personal vehicles or rideshares the most common modes of transport. Navigating the area during peak event times requires patience; arriving at least 45-60 minutes before game time is recommended to account for local traffic and find convenient parking.

Mission San Jose

7.0 mi

A bit further afield but still within a 15-minute drive, Mission San Jose is part of the historic San Antonio Missions National Historical Park. This offers a significant cultural and historical experience, allowing visitors to explore a beautifully preserved Spanish colonial mission. It's an excellent opportunity for those interested in history or seeking a more profound local experience beyond the sports events, providing a rich backdrop for a cultural outing.

Mi Tierra Cafe & Bakery

10.0 mi

A San Antonio institution located in Market Square, Mi Tierra is famous for its authentic Mexican cuisine and 24/7 operation. The vibrant, festive atmosphere, complete with mariachi music and colorful decorations, makes it a memorable dining experience. It's an excellent spot for experiencing classic Tex-Mex dishes and enjoying the lively spirit of the city.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in San Antonio is generally mild, with average daytime temperatures in the 50s and 60s Fahrenheit. While comfortable for outdoor events, occasional cold fronts can bring temperatures down into the 30s and 40s, so layering clothing is advised. Light jackets or sweaters are usually sufficient for spectators and athletes.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ings warming temperatures, typically ranging from the 70s to the 80s Fahrenheit, making it excellent for outdoor sports. Early summer continues this trend, but temperatures can begin to climb significantly. Light, breathable clothing is ideal. Occasional rain showers can occur, so checking forecasts before heading to events is wise.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er in San Antonio is characterized by high heat and humidity, with temperatures frequently in the 90s and sometimes exceeding 100 Fahrenheit. Extended periods outdoors require diligent hydration, sun protection (hats, sunscreen), and seeking shade whenever possible. Events may be scheduled earlier or later to avoid peak heat.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ers a welcome reprieve from summer heat, with temperatures gradually cooling from the 80s into the 70s and 60s Fahrenheit. This season is often considered ideal for outdoor athletics, providing comfortable conditions for both participants and spectators. Early fall might still feel warm, so lighter attire is practical, while later months may call for an extra layer.

📅

Rain & snow

Rainfall in San Antonio is most common in the spring and fall. Thunderstorms can occur, often bringing brief but heavy downpours. Snow is rare but can happen during winter cold snaps, potentially causing minor travel disruptions. Event organizers will monitor weather conditions closely and communicate any schedule changes due to severe weather.
